No, I did not make a spelling mistake. This device is Czech and has absolutely nothing to do with OPL (Foca).
It is a pseudo-SLR, made of bakelite, with a lens (probably a meniscus) 8/75. The shutter Fokar 2 allows speeds between 1/25 and 1/100, plus B exposure. There are two apertures: 8 and 16.
It is a manufacture by Druopta for a Dutch dealer in Rotterdam. Foka means Foto Optiek Kino Albers.
